The Navigate Approach

Every school or setting is different. Our work is never off-the-shelf.

We partner with you to understand your context, clarify pressures and build practical solutions that last. Much of our support follows our three-part process: Decode, Systemise & Upskill. 

We help schools move from insight to aligned systems and confident practice.

You may need focused review work, structured system development or targeted professional learning. Some schools want the full journey. We shape our involvement around what will be most purposeful for you.

DECODE: Understanding what is really happening — not what it looks like on the surface.

A blended diagnostic that combines structured online analysis with half a day in person in your school.

We observe systems in action, experience the culture first-hand, and explore the realities behind the data. A focused feedback session with leaders provides clear strengths, pressure points and practical priorities.

Our insight is informed by how stress, safety and connection shape behaviour, translating evidence and experience into grounded next steps.

This approach allows findings to be tested against lived experience, ensuring that recommendations are both accurate and workable.
